
Your Safety in the Skies: Etihad Airways Takes a Bold Step
Imagine soaring through the clouds, watching the world shrink beneath you. Air travel can be a magical experience, yet turbulence remains a common worry for parents and young travelers alike. Recently, Etihad Airways joined the International Air Transport Association's (IATA) Turbulence Aware Programme, marking a significant move towards enhancing flight safety and passenger confidence. This exciting development is designed to tackle a concern shared by many—how to make flying more comfortable and secure.
Understanding the Turbulence Aware Programme
The IATA's Turbulence Aware Programme is all about improving how airlines gather and share information regarding turbulence. Think of it as a team effort among global airlines to keep each other informed about the skies above. When planes from various airlines share their experiences and data, it helps predict turbulence patterns and manage in-flight experiences better. This collaborative spirit is particularly reassuring for parents traveling with children, ensuring that everyone on board gets the safest trip possible.
The Journey of Etihad Airways: From Abu Dhabi to the World
Etihad Airways, the national airline of the United Arab Emirates, has always put a premium on passenger welfare. With the introduction of their participation in this programme, they are stepping up their game. Founded in 2003, Etihad is relatively young compared to its competitors, yet they have quickly made a name for themselves as a luxurious and innovative airline. By joining the Turbulence Aware Programme, they showcase their commitment to modern air travel's evolving demands and passenger needs.
